"Nvidia's Blackwell Platform: A Game-Changer for Investors"

Nvidia unveiled a new high-speed processor at its annual developer conference, "A.I. Woodstock," aiming to capitalize on the growing demand for artificial intelligence technology. Despite the company's soaring stock and ambitious vision for A.I.-powered industrial revolution, investors gave the event a tough grade, leading to a drop in premarket trading. CEO Jensen Huang presented the new chip, Blackwell, as the engine to power this new industrial revolution, but investor scrutiny continues as the company's sky-high valuation comes under question.

"Nvidia's Stock Valuation and Investor Sentiment: What to Watch in 2024"

Bank of America increased its price target for Nvidia to $1,100, citing a lower forward P/E ratio compared to November 2022 and suggesting a 24% potential upside even at a $2 trillion valuation. Despite the stock's 80% YTD surge, it is still trading at lower valuations than in 2022, and ownership levels indicate room for further upside. The upcoming "AI Woodstock" event on March 18 could provide additional momentum, as Nvidia is set to unveil the successor to its H100 chip and showcase the impact of genAI and digital twins across various markets.
